HERE’S THE STORY
DETROIT -- January 7, 2015: Ahead
of its debut at the North American International Auto Show, Chevrolet today
introduced the 2017 Cruze Hatchback. Developed with all the technologies
and dynamic driving attributes of the all-new 2016 Cruze sedan, the new
hatch adds a functional and sporty choice for customers. It joins Colorado
and Trax as the latest Chevrolets to push into new segments.
PRODUCT DETAILS
The Cruze Hatch has the same, class-leading
106.3-inch (2,700 mm) wheelbase as sedan models, but features a unique roof
and rear-end structure – including wraparound taillamps and an
integrated spoiler at the top of the liftgate. It opens to offer 22.7 cubic
feet (643 liters) of cargo space behind the rear seat. With the rear seat
folded, cargo space expands to 47.2 cubic feet (1,336 liters).

ABOUT THE NEW CRUZE
An all-new, more
rigid and lighter architecture is the Cruze’s foundation for driving
dynamism, while also playing a significant role in safety and efficiency.
It is more than 200 pounds (91 kg) lighter than the previous-generation
model due largely to a body structure that is 100 pounds lighter and an
engine that’s 44 pounds (20 kg) lighter.
The Cruze lineup in North America is offered in L, LS, LT and Premier – and a more expressive RS package, featuring unique front and rear fascias, rocker panels, rear spoiler, fog lamps and – on the Premier model – 18-inch wheels.
The 2017 Cruze Hatch will be offered in LT and Premier trims, and with the RS package.
KEY FEATURES
- Segment-exclusive standard Apple CarPlay and Android Auto compatibility via the MyLink radio systems and available 4G LTE with Wi-Fi hotspot
- More standard safety features than any other compact car – including Corolla and Civic – with available adaptive features including Lane Keep Assist, Rear Cross Traffic Alert, Side Blind Zone Alert and Rear Park Assist
- Available Teen Driver feature helps support safe driving habits and offers driving statistics for parents
- Standard 1.4L turbo engine with direct injection and Stop/Start technologies, electric power steering and, on Premier models, a Z-link rear suspension
- Interior with midsize-level roominess, including two inches greater rear legroom than Ford Focus and Hyundai Elantra
- Available features include a heated steering wheel, heated front and rear seats, Athens leather-appointed seating surfaces, true French seams and halogen projector-beam headlamps with LED signature lighting.
FAST FACTS
- Cruze is Chevrolet’s best-selling car around the world, with 3.5 million sold since it went on sale in 2008
- Since Cruze’s introduction, Chevrolet’s retail share of the segment has grown from 5.8 to 9.4 percent
- 35 percent of Cruze customers are new to Chevrolet
- In the U.S., Cruze is the segment’s second-best seller to customers under 25.
